About Me
I am a Software Engineer passionate about leveraging technology to create impactful user experiences and streamline processes. With a background in web development and audio engineering, I bring a unique perspective to solving technical challenges.
Technical Skills
- Languages & Frameworks: JavaScript, TypeScript, Python, React, Redux, Node.js, Django
- Databases: MySQL, PostgreSQL, MongoDB
- Development Practices: Agile/Scrum, TDD, Performance Optimization, Code Reviews
- Tools & Technologies: GraphQL, Docker, AWS, NGINX, Webpack, Babel
Professional Experience
7-Eleven - Senior Software Developer (Aug 2021 - Present)
- Developed SEO-optimized pages with Server-Side Rendering (SSR) and transitioned the platform to Next.js and TypeScript.
- Implemented a GraphQL server to interface with databases and legacy REST APIs.
- Created a subscription service (7Now Gold Pass) and dynamic UX components for personalized content and promotions.
- Expanded payment capabilities, integrating third-party APIs like Apple Pay and PayPal.
Digz - Full Stack Software Engineer (Nov 2020 - Aug 2021)
- Enhanced a full-stack web application using React, Python, Django, and PostgreSQL.
- Overhauled the frontend with a focus on responsive design and modern usability.
- Integrated third-party APIs and implemented dynamic auto-suggest functionality.
Confidence Systems - Frontend Developer (Oct 2020)
- Built features using React, Redux, TypeScript, and Node.js in a fast-paced startup environment.
- Followed TDD principles to deliver high-quality results.
Education
- Hack Reactor - Advanced Software Engineering Immersive (2020)
- Belmont University - Bachelor of Business Administration (2015)